Southern Beach Getaways in Winter
For those looking to experience the beach during winter, places like Florida and Alabama provide an escape from the cold. Florida’s coastal towns, such as Key West and Miami, enjoy pleasant weather, offering visitors a relaxing atmosphere with fewer crowds. The Gulf Coast in Alabama also offers sandy beaches and mild winter temperatures, making it a great spot for a winter vacation by the sea.

Cultural Experiences in the South During Winter
The south is also rich in cultural destinations perfect for a winter visit. Cities like New Orleans and Charleston provide an opportunity to explore historic sites, local art, and unique architecture. In New Orleans, you can enjoy vibrant cultural festivals even in the colder months, while Charleston offers southern charm and delicious cuisine in a mild winter setting.
